British Official Wireless. (Received 1 pjn.) RUGBY, January 27. Extensive flooding of agricultural land, roads and railways followed the snow, rain and gales of yesterdav, when the worst weather conditions for | some years were experienced, j Twenty East Anglia Villages are isolated.
